Suede upper Leather stacked heel, .5" (10mm) Leather sole with rubber insert Leather lining and footbed Metallic leather piping Handmade in Toscana, Italy
Suede upper Leather stacked heel, .5" (10mm) Leather sole with rubber insert Leather lining and footbed Metallic leather piping Handmade in Toscana, Italy